2.64  Assistance by bureau.

The legislative service bureau may provide the following assistance to standing and special interim study committees, as authorized by the legislative council:

1.  Handle administrative affairs, including correspondence, record keeping, and scheduling of meetings.

2.  Perform the research required for any study. Priority for studies shall be determined by the legislative council.

3.  Arrange for the help of state employees and technical consultants whose assistance is needed.

4.  Prepare research reports, and, upon the request of a committee, prepare that committee's report.

Section History: Early form

  [C62, 66, § 2.60; C71, 73, 75, 77, 79, 81, § 2.64]
